Apple iPhone Still Ahead, Top Rival Not Far Away

The latest numbers announced by Parks Associates shows that Apple is still leading the smartphone market but the lead is not as big as we thought it will be with Samsung, their biggest rival tagging closely behind them.

Based on the smartphone market share numbers right now, Apple and their iPhone holds a total of 40% while Samsung holds about 31%. The two brands are currently far ahead of the rest of the best with the next in line being LG with only 10% of shares.
